Clay .. There's a type of electric fence commonly called a "weed burner" that produces a continuous voltage rather than a +/- one second pulse. The concept is for the voltage to burn away any vegetation that grows into contact with the fence. Many years ago I had a neighbor that used a neon

Joe- understand and thanks very much for the help.  Paul kc2nyu >> You will need to make sure no other program is currently using theCAT Port. >>Windows does not allow sharing of ports. Any program using a port must close (release) the port before another program can open (begin using it).
